Transaction 2915bede094177dfcec812754367338dbba263b70a882e74edc8608559b39fcf
1 Input
1 Output
-
2915bede094177dfcec812754367338dbba263b70a882e74edc8608559b39fcf:0
- value
- 154230
- script pubkey
- OP_0 OP_PUSHBYTES_20 cdb4d34d6366501d256967db858b0f87e0a3b4d9
- address
- bc1qek6dxntrvegp6ftfvldctzc0sls28dxewgh60v